    Why not just use full power, atleast you get more power with it. What are the advantages of using punches and when should you use them?

    Just kidding.  In real golf "punch" is a shot technique you use to keep the ball flight lower than normal to go under tree branches or into a strong headwind.  It is an effective shot but does travel less distance.

    I dont use it a lot. Maybe ocassional second shot into very strong head wind.

    Most effective hitting out of rough, keeping the ball flight low and getting good run on the fairways.

    Also especially useful if you are hitting to a down hill green.

    It can also be an extremely useful skill (more on kiawah than bethpage) to run a ball up to the hole.  Much more reliable and less affected by 'the beast' (search it if you don't know it).  You have to know the actual carry and roll yardages of the shots though.  It takes some time to get it down, so you'll need to practice it.

    It can also be used sometimes if you are in between clubs and you want to use a full swing meter as not to throw off your rhythm. Obviously, this can only be done if you have plenty of room to run the ball.
